    Botanical Overview Epilobium parviflorum, commonly known as Small-flowered Willowherb or Hairy Willowherb, belongs to the Onagraceae family. Native to Europe, Western Asia, and Northwest Africa, this species primarily uses its aerial parts, leaves, and flowers in herbal applications.     Botanical Overview Chamerion angustifolium, commonly known as Fireweed or Rosebay willowherb, is a perennial herbaceous plant in the Onagraceae family. It is native to temperate regions of the Northern Hemisphere including Europe, North America, and Asia.     Botanical Overview Oenothera biennis, commonly known as Evening primrose, is a biennial flowering plant in the Onagraceae family. Native to North America but widely naturalized in Europe and Western Asia, its seeds, leaves, roots, and flowers are utilized medicinally.
